Veterinary Customer Service: This Is a Barking Great Opportunity

Pleasant Valley Animal Hospital is an established, locally owned and operated practice in New York’s gorgeous Hudson Valley, and we’re seeking a full-time Client Services Representative to join our team. Veterinary experience isn’t necessary, but we’d love to hear from you if you have client service experience in a healthcare setting. In addition to all the pet hair and weird poop stories you can handle, we can offer you:

  • Above average hourly wage
  • No weekends
  • Flexibility in schedule, especially for students
  • Employee discount for pet care
  • Mentorship and learning opportunities in areas of interest direct from veterinarian owner
  • Other CE opportunities
  • Friendly, fun work environment that’s never boring

While it’s great if you love animals, what this position really needs is someone who has stellar communication skills and loves people just as much. You’re going to be manning the phones and the front desk of our hospital, which includes:

  • Check-in/check-out of clients and patients
  • Answering questions about everything from pricing to why their cat is doing that
  • Setting and confirming appointments
  • Calming a pet owner whose puppy just ate a whole tube of toothpaste (including the tube)
  • Taking payments from clients who think veterinary hospitals should be non-profits
  • Assorted other clerical and administrative duties as needed

Practice Manager Wanted: Excellent Compensation Package, Opportunity to Grow!

We are looking for a full-time practice manager to join our team of skilled and compassionate animal lovers in providing exceptional veterinary care and customer service to the pet population of Pleasant Valley. The practice manager is the heart of our team. The primary purpose and function of the practice manager is to manage the hospital and ensure that we provide the highest quality of veterinary care to our patients, as well as exceptional customer service to our clients. The successful candidate will also be responsible for maximizing both employee engagement and the productivity of the veterinary medical team.

 In partnership with the practice owner, the practice manager ensures good communication with clients, associates, and employees to optimize growth of the business. The practice manager also partners with the practice owner to operate an effective and productive hospital team, ensure a safe and engaging hospital environment, and improve both the medical quality and business performance of the hospital. 

Desired experience, education, and training

  • Bachelor’s degree in business or related discipline preferred, or the equivalent combination of education, training and experience that prov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ities.
  • Three years’ related experience required (health care, veterinary profession, service industry, etc.), including direct supervisory experience (includes hiring, employee development, etc.)
  • Private or corporate veterinary hospital experience and/or previous experience as a practice manager in veterinary medicine preferred.
  • Veterinary technician certification, licensure, and experience preferred.
  • Certified Veterinary Practice Manager (CVPM) or Veterinary Management Institute (CVPA) certification preferred.
